US President Donald Trump says he may cut tariffs on China to help seal a deal for short video app TikTok to be sold by its owner ByteDance. Trump also said he was willing to extend a 5 April deadline for a non-Chinese buyer of the platform to be found. In a ceremony held at the Nsawam Medium Security Prison, 71 inmates graduated from a tertiary education programme, with three inmates earning first-class honors. The Bulk Energy Storage and Transportation Company Limited (BOST) has renewed its partnership with Burkina Faso’s National Hydrocarbons Company (SONABHY) to enhance cross-border petroleum trade and strengthen sub-regional energy security.
